Comprendre les nuances des unités CSS : pt vs. px
Lors de la définition de styles en CSS, vous pouvez rencontrer la possibilité d'utiliser l'un ou l'autre des points (pt) ou pixels (px) comme unités pour spécifier les dimensions. Le choix de l'unité appropriée est crucial pour garantir la compatibilité entre navigateurs et créer une mise en page visuellement cohérente.
L'illusion des pixels
Contrairement aux hypothèses courantes, l'unité px dans CSS diffère des pixels physiques. Au lieu de cela, il représente une unité « magique » conçue pour maintenir la cohérence sur une gamme de matériels et de résolutions. Essentiellement, chaque unité px est destinée à restituer une seule et fine ligne à peine visible.
Considérez l'appareil
L'interprétation précise de px dépend de l'appareil et son utilisation prévue. Par exemple, sur un téléphone portable tenu près des yeux, 1 px peut apparaître plus petit que sur un écran d'ordinateur vu à bout de bras. En conséquence, px garantit que les lignes restent nettes et visibles quel que soit l'appareil.
Comparaison de pt et px
Bien que px ne soit pas directement lié aux pixels physiques, pt (points) définit une unité absolue égale à 1/72 de pouce. Cela signifie que 72 pt équivaut toujours à 1 pouce. pt est couramment utilisé pour la conception d'impression et est essentiel lorsque des mesures précises sont requises, en particulier pour l'impression haute résolution.
Quand utiliser pt vs. px
Le choix entre pt et px dépend des exigences spécifiques de votre conception. Pour la plupart des applications Web, px est généralement préféré en raison de sa flexibilité et de sa facilité de conversion entre différents appareils. Cependant, si une précision absolue est essentielle, notamment pour la mise en page d'impression, pt pourrait être le choix le plus judicieux.
En résumé, pt représente une unité absolue basée sur les pouces, tandis que px est une unité « magique » qui garantit une apparence cohérente. sur différents appareils. En comprenant leurs distinctions, vous pouvez prendre des décisions éclairées et créer des designs visuellement attrayants qui s'adaptent parfaitement à une multitude de plateformes.
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!